Where to network in the summer?

Used the search button, but couldn't exactly find the answer to my question - should I focus on one geographical location to network during the summer, or spend time in more locations?

For example, should I spend a week networking in NYC for SA recruiting, or spend 4 days in NY and 3 days in LA/SF/Chicago. All of the cities I mentioned have strong alumni network and tbh I have no particular preference to each (maybe NY is slightly better). Do I get a better result targeting one location?
